From adbc0b0aa7e522b4a9302c082547e7bd889d0953 Mon Sep 17 00:00:00 2001 From: Mumit Khan Date: Tue, 29 Feb 2000 03:16:14 +0000 Subject: [PATCH] 2000-02-28 Mumit Khan * include/largeint.h: Rename HAVE_INT64 macro to _HAVE_INT64 to avoid namespace pollution. * include/rpcndr.h: Likewise. * include/winnt.h: Likewise. --- winsup/w32api/include/largeint.h | 2 +- winsup/w32api/include/rpcndr.h | 2 +- winsup/w32api/include/winnt.h | 6 +++--- 3 files changed, 5 insertions(+), 5 deletions(-) diff --git a/winsup/w32api/include/largeint.h b/winsup/w32api/include/largeint.h index 1e90de07d..c36db31ef 100644 --- a/winsup/w32api/include/largeint.h +++ b/winsup/w32api/include/largeint.h @@ -13,7 +13,7 @@ extern "C" { #endif -#ifdef HAVE_INT64 +#ifdef _HAVE_INT64 #define _toi (__int64) #define _toui (unsigned __int64) #else diff --git a/winsup/w32api/include/rpcndr.h b/winsup/w32api/include/rpcndr.h index 8b6c37b45..8d8bd0d57 100644 --- a/winsup/w32api/include/rpcndr.h +++ b/winsup/w32api/include/rpcndr.h @@ -32,7 +32,7 @@ extern "C" { #define __MIDL_DECLSPEC_DLLIMPORT #define __MIDL_DECLSPEC_DLLEXPORT #endif -#if defined(HAVE_INT64) || (defined(_INTEGRAL_MAX_BITS) && _INTEGRAL_MAX_BITS >= 64) +#if defined(_HAVE_INT64) || (defined(_INTEGRAL_MAX_BITS) && _INTEGRAL_MAX_BITS >= 64) #define hyper __int64 #define MIDL_uhyper unsigned __int64 #else diff --git a/winsup/w32api/include/winnt.h b/winsup/w32api/include/winnt.h index 4574136d2..7f08e2810 100644 --- a/winsup/w32api/include/winnt.h +++ b/winsup/w32api/include/winnt.h @@ -99,12 +99,12 @@ typedef DWORD LCID; typedef PDWORD PLCID; typedef WORD LANGID; #ifdef __GNUC__ -#define HAVE_INT64 +#define _HAVE_INT64 #define _INTEGRAL_MAX_BITS 64 #undef __int64 #define __int64 long long #endif -#if defined(HAVE_INT64) || (defined(_INTEGRAL_MAX_BITS) && _INTEGRAL_MAX_BITS >= 64) +#if defined(_HAVE_INT64) || (defined(_INTEGRAL_MAX_BITS) && _INTEGRAL_MAX_BITS >= 64) typedef __int64 LONGLONG; typedef unsigned __int64 DWORDLONG; #else @@ -114,7 +114,7 @@ typedef LONGLONG *PLONGLONG; typedef DWORDLONG *PDWORDLONG; typedef DWORDLONG ULONGLONG,*PULONGLONG; typedef LONGLONG USN; -#ifdef HAVE_INT64 +#ifdef _HAVE_INT64 #define Int32x32To64(a,b) ((LONGLONG)(a)*(LONGLONG)(b)) #define UInt32x32To64(a,b) ((DWORDLONG)(a)*(DWORDLONG)(b)) #define Int64ShllMod32(a,b) ((DWORDLONG)(a)<<(b)) -- 2.43.5